SQLServer全局变量使用注意事项与数据库管理
需积分: 50 123 浏览量
更新于2024-07-12
收藏 9.41MB PPT 举报
"这篇资料主要涉及SQL Server的学习,特别是关于全局变量的使用注意事项以及SQL Server 2000的相关技术内容。"
在SQL Server中,全局变量是服务器级别的变量,它们不由用户的特定程序定义,而是预定义在系统级别。使用全局变量时,有几点需要注意:
1. **全局变量定义**:全局变量并非由用户程序直接创建,而是由系统在服务器层面上定义和管理的特殊变量。
2. **访问限制**:用户只能使用系统已经提供的全局变量,无法自定义新的全局变量。
3. **引用方式**:在引用全局变量时,必须以两个连续的下划线"@@"作为前缀来标识,例如"@@RowCount"或"@@Identity"等,这些都是常见的内置全局变量。
4. **命名冲突**:避免将局部变量的名称与全局变量的名称相同,因为这可能导致程序执行时的混乱和不可预见的结果。如果这样做,局部变量可能会无意中覆盖或被全局变量的值影响,从而影响程序逻辑。
SQL Server 2008是SQL Server系列的一个重要版本,它提供了更多的功能和改进,包括更强大的数据处理能力、更高效的查询优化以及更完善的安全管理机制。学习SQL Server不仅需要了解基本的Transact-SQL语言,还涉及到服务器管理和数据库管理,如数据库的创建、备份、恢复以及性能调优等。
在服务器管理方面,理解如何配置和管理SQL Server实例,设置服务、登录账户和权限,以及使用SQL Server Management Studio (SSMS)等工具至关重要。数据库管理则包括数据库的创建、删除、备份和恢复操作,以及对表、视图、存储过程等数据库对象的操作。
SQL Server的权限管理是确保数据安全性的重要环节,通过角色、用户和权限的设定,可以控制不同用户对数据库的访问级别。SQL Server代理服务用于自动化数据库维护任务,如计划备份和索引重建。数据复制功能则支持数据在多个服务器间同步,适用于分布式系统和灾难恢复策略。数据转换服务(DTS,现在称为Integration Services, SSIS)则用于数据集成和ETL(提取、转换、加载)流程。
在学习SQL Server的过程中,记住定期备份数据和采用替换法进行问题排查是非常重要的法则。备份可以防止数据丢失,而问题对比分析可以帮助定位和解决问题。SQL Server 2000虽然相对较旧,但其基础原理和技术对于理解后续版本仍然非常有价值,它在易用性、扩展性、可靠性和数据仓库支持等方面的优秀表现也为后来的版本奠定了坚实的基础。
2013-04-16 上传
2011-10-25 上传
2009-03-20 上传
2009-03-02 上传
2021-04-07 上传
2013-10-16 上传
2022-10-31 上传
点击了解资源详情
点击了解资源详情
杜浩明
- 粉丝: 13
- 资源: 2万+
最新资源
- Fisher Iris Setosa数据的主成分分析及可视化- Matlab实现
- 深入理解JavaScript类与面向对象编程
- Argspect-0.0.1版本Python包发布与使用说明
- OpenNetAdmin v09.07.15 PHP项目源码下载
- 掌握Node.js: 构建高性能Web服务器与应用程序
- Matlab矢量绘图工具:polarG函数使用详解
- 实现Vue.js中PDF文件的签名显示功能
- 开源项目PSPSolver:资源约束调度问题求解器库
- 探索vwru系统:大众的虚拟现实招聘平台
- 深入理解cJSON:案例与源文件解析
- 多边形扩展算法在MATLAB中的应用与实现
- 用React类组件创建迷你待办事项列表指南
- Python库setuptools-58.5.3助力高效开发
- fmfiles工具:在MATLAB中查找丢失文件并列出错误
- 老枪二级域名系统PHP源码简易版发布
- 探索DOSGUI开源库:C/C++图形界面开发新篇章